The Last Days 

You hear, and even see on Facebook people say all the time. That’s another sign we are living in the last days. The end of the world is near and everyone is going to die, and they seem to be so excited about it. But the fact is, the Bible does not teach this. The Bible does mention the last days. But when it talks about the last days, it’s no where near what people make that term out to be today. Let’s examine the Bible’s “Last Days”.
